《沉浸式虚拟现实游戏开发实战指南:人工智能与跨平台适配技术深度解析》下载介绍

沉浸式虚拟现实游戏开发实战指南人工智能与跨平台适配技术深度解析

一、产品简介:开启VR游戏开发的未来之门

《沉浸式虚拟现实游戏开发实战指南:人工智能与跨平台适配技术深度解析》是一本面向开发者、技术爱好者的权威指南,全面覆盖VR游戏开发的核心技术与实践策略。本书以“从理论到落地”为主线,结合人工智能(AI)与跨平台适配两大前沿领域,系统解析如何打造高沉浸感、高交互性的VR游戏。

在VR技术快速发展的背景下,开发者不仅需要掌握基础的3D建模、物理引擎和渲染技术,还需应对多平台适配的复杂性和AI驱动的智能交互需求。本书通过丰富的案例(如动态场景生成、智能NPC行为设计)和实战代码(基于Unity、Unreal等主流引擎),帮助读者突破技术瓶颈,实现从创意到商业化产品的跨越。

二、核心功能解析:从技术到落地的全链路覆盖

1. 全流程开发指南:从零构建VR世界

本书以实战为导向,详细拆解VR游戏开发的每个环节:

  • 环境搭建:涵盖Unity、Unreal Engine的配置与优化,支持Windows、Android、iOS等多平台开发环境部署。
  • 核心模块实现:包括3D场景构建、物理碰撞检测、动态光影渲染等,提供可复用的代码模板(如角色控制器、动作捕捉算法)。
  • AI集成:从基础的行为树到深度强化学习,指导开发者实现NPC智能决策、玩家行为预测等高级功能。
  • 2. 智能NPC与动态内容生成

    通过AI技术,本书展示了如何让虚拟角色更“人性化”:

  • 情感交互:利用自然语言处理(NLP)和面部表情捕捉技术,使NPC能够根据玩家情绪做出动态反应。
  • 动态剧情生成:基于生成对抗网络(GAN)和扩散模型,实现游戏剧情、关卡的自动生成,提升游戏可玩性。
  • 自适应难度系统:AI算法实时分析玩家操作习惯,动态调整游戏难度,平衡挑战性与趣味性。
  • 3. 跨平台适配技术:打破设备壁垒

    针对多平台开发的痛点,本书提供了一套完整的解决方案:

  • 统一中间件设计:通过语义解析与数据转译技术,实现PC、VR头显、移动端等设备的无缝兼容。
  • 实时性能优化:利用AI动态监测设备性能(如GPU负载、网络带宽),自动调整渲染精度和数据加载策略,确保低端设备也能流畅运行。
  • 云游戏支持:结合5G与边缘计算,实现游戏流媒体的多端同步,玩家可随时切换设备继续游戏。
  • 4. 沉浸式交互与物理反馈

  • 触觉反馈集成:详解如何通过力反馈手套、体感设备增强玩家的触觉沉浸感,例如模拟武器后坐力、环境震动等。
  • 语音与手势控制:集成语音识别(如Azure Speech)和手势追踪库,支持自然交互方式,减少传统手柄的依赖。
  • 三、独特优势:为何选择这本指南?

    1. 多引擎兼容,覆盖主流开发需求

    不同于单一引擎教程,本书同时涵盖Unity和Unreal Engine的深度开发技巧,并对比两者在VR项目中的适用场景:

  • Unity:适合快速原型开发与跨平台部署,尤其在移动端和轻量级应用中表现优异。
  • Unreal Engine:在画面表现力与复杂物理模拟上更具优势,适合高端VR设备和3A级项目。
  • 书中提供双引擎的代码对照示例,帮助开发者灵活选择技术栈。

    2. AI与跨平台技术的深度整合

    市面同类书籍多将AI与跨平台技术分开讨论,而本书首次将两者结合:

  • AI驱动的跨平台优化:例如通过机器学习预测不同设备的性能瓶颈,提前优化资源分配。
  • 智能内容适配:AI自动生成多分辨率纹理、简化版3D模型,确保同一游戏在高端PC与移动端均能呈现最佳效果。
  • 3. 实战案例与行业洞察

  • 行业级项目剖析:包括《半衰期:艾利克斯》的交互设计、《Beat Saber》的节奏算法等,揭示成功项目的底层逻辑。
  • 前沿趋势解读:探讨元宇宙中的跨平台互通、云游戏商业模式等,为开发者提供长期技术规划参考。
  • 4. 开源资源与社区支持

    附赠的代码库包含完整的VR项目模板、AI模型预训练数据,并链接至开发者社区(如GitHub、CSDN专题),持续更新技术答疑与行业动态。

    四、迈向VR开发的新高度

    《沉浸式虚拟现实游戏开发实战指南:人工智能与跨平台适配技术深度解析》不仅是技术手册,更是通往下一代交互体验的路线图。无论是独立开发者还是大型团队,都能通过本书掌握AI与跨平台适配的核心竞争力,在VR游戏红海中脱颖而出。

    立即下载,解锁VR开发的无限可能!

    引用来源